Thursday, August 20, 2020
Presented by Civitas Advisors, Miles Partnership and Tourism Economics

Funding Futures: The Impact and Future of Tourism & DMO Funding in Response & Recovery from COVID-19

This webinar summarizes the findings and recommendations from "Funding Futures," a major study of the recovery and future of tourism and DMO funding coming out of the COVID-19 crisis. The project analyzed 115 North American cities, all 50 U.S. states and 10 Canadian provinces to summarize the current situation, the impact of the COVID-19 crisis, and the outlook for recovery. The study also introduces and explores nine alternative funding options for DMOs to be “built back better” – options for more balanced, resilient and sustainable funding. 

John Lambeth of Civitas, Chris Adams of Miles Partnership, Adam Sacks of Tourism Economics and Erin Francis-Cummings of Destination Analysts, along with Al Hutchinson of Visit Baltimore and Cathy Ritter of the Colorado Tourism Office, discuss this essential update on your DMO’s funding future.

Thursday, May 30, 2019
Presented by ADARA

The Marketing and Research Challenge: Riding the Wave of Data

For many travel marketers, while research shows that personalization is important, the path to getting there is still unclear. The problem is pervasive across the travel industry with only 38% of travel companies rating their ability to personalize at four or five stars out of five. For years, travel marketers have lagged behind in the trend of prioritizing data-driven marketing—but there is good reason to start to emphasize it.

On this webinar, Andria Godfrey, senior director, global customer success, and Ted Sullivan, vice president, destinations, Europe, ADARA will:

  • Share key insights into the tiered journey to personalization and measurement.
  • Demonstrate how travel marketers can significantly increase the relevance and understanding of their brands.
  • Debate how a few global travel brands are driving personalization and redefining measurement in travel.
